Description:
This build takes advantage of the new bard epic spells included in HG, going
for 7 epic spells !, as well as perfect curses, songs and bard buffs,debuffs and heals.
Im using Half-Celestial which works very good for this build.
Base race: Human
(HC adjustment) (Siren adjustment)
Stat | Lvl 1 | Lvl 40 | Lvl 60 |
Dex | 8 (8) (10) | (8) (10) | (8) (10) |
Str | 8 (8) (6) | (8) (6) | (8) (6) |
Con | 16 (16) (14) | (26) (22) | (26) (22) |
Int | 16 | 16 | 16 |
Wis | 8 (14) (8) | (14) (8) | (14) (8) |
Cha | 16 (20) (18) | 22 | 32 |
Level Breakdown:
12 Bard, 1 Paladin, 5 Bard, 1 Monk, 21 Bard
Skills:
You can max concentration, discipline, heal, lore, perform, umd and tumble whenever you want.
After this you will have 41 skill points left in lvl 40, split them up in pick pocket and spellcraft.
Stats:
(Half celestial) All stat points to Con
(Siren) 8 points to con, 2 to cha
Level | Feat (Half-Celestial) | Feat (Siren) |
1 | Toughness, Curse song | Same |
3 | Spell focus: Enchantment | Same |
6 | Greater sf: Enchantment | Same |
9 | Extend spell | Same |
12 | Silent spell | Same |
15 | Spell focus: Trans | Same |
18 | Greater sf: Trans | Same |
21 | Combat casting | Same |
24 | Lasting Inspiration | Spell focus: Evocation |
25 | (Bonus) Imp. combat casting | Same |
27 | Spell focus: Illusion | Same |
28 | (Bonus)Lingering song | Lasting Inspiration |
30 | Spell focus: Divination | Same |
31 | (Bonus) Greater sf: Illusion | Same |
33 | Spell focus: Conjuration | Same |
34 | (Bonus) Greater sf: Divination | Same |
36 | Greater sf: Conjuration | Same |
37 | (Bonus) Great Charisma 1 | Same |
39 | Epic skill focus: Perform | Greater sf: Evocation |
40 | (Bonus) Great Charisma 2 | Same |
Book: Necromancy
(Half Celestial) Gets Greater focus Evocation for free.
Legendary levels:
6 x Epic spell focuses
LL enchantment @ lvl 60
All stat points to Charisma
Final saves:
Fort: 75
Reflex: 70
Will: 73
Final HP: 1251
Pros:
Extremely high saves
High hp (1251)
Master of epics, 7 powerful epics to use each rest
Excellent song capabilities
Can gmw +14 and keen anything
High heal skill gives very nice healing circles.
Good party buffs from spells and bard abilities.
SR 70 and levitation
Can use any scroll
Cons:
No meelee capability
Crappy ac, depends on buffs to survive, should carry a bunch of GS scrolls for emergencies.
No epics until lvl 57.
Alternative:
* If you want the 8th epic, skip Great Cha 1+2 for Greater spell focus: Abjuration.
In LL take Epic spell focis: Abjuration instead of LL enchantment.
I decided to go without as the Soaking ability wont be that fantastic wih charisma of 42. (16/+20).
With several epic warding sources available, the 50/+20 will often be active anyway.
* Epic sf: perform, lingering song, great cha1 and great cha2 can be replaced
without destroying the essence of the build. You could in fact get 4 Great cons instead for additional 120 HP, its a matter of preference and both options will yield decent results, but the one Ive chosen makes it more
flexible in terms of items. As well as I like the fact that you can start your Hells fun at lvl 57 instead of 60.
* You can also focus more on Charisma, it will yield a better effect for the abjuration epic, but the changes elsewhere are minimal, and better saves are definatly not needed.
